Method
Preparation
- Peel the bananas and slice them thinly to about 1/8 inch (3 mm).
- In a small bowl, stir together the cinnamon and sugar until evenly blended.
- Gently toss the banana slices in the cinnamon-sugar mixture until evenly coated.
Cooking
- Preheat the air fryer to 350°F (175°C).
- Lightly coat the air fryer basket with cooking spray or a thin layer of oil.
- Arrange the banana slices in a single layer in the basket.
- Cook at 350°F (175°C) for 10–15 minutes, flipping halfway through. Check at the 10-minute mark.
- Transfer the chips to a wire rack or parchment paper to cool completely for 5–10 minutes.
Notes
Slice evenly for best results; don't skip the cooling step, as they will crisp up as they cool. These chips can be served plain, over yogurt, or as part of a trail mix.
